Composing in Python has actually brought back a great deal of happiness from every one of Computer Science, which I thought would certainly come back to me as well as I did not make a mistake. So just what? Do I assume that every person ought to now leap to the HTML training course and produce their initial page?
However it is not necessarily a means for everybody
This is not a poor suggestion, since doing it will certainly not take much time, and also it is really satisfying. However it is not necessarily a means for everybody. During my research studies, my teacher usually pointed out that we need to create programs for individual usage on a daily basis.
If you intend to take care of information handling, you have knowledge of stats and you wish to utilize all of it for modeling – try R or Python. R is based upon MatLab and also has more of a mathematical technique, which could be quite an asset. If you want to create mobile applications – consider Java and also programming on Android or iOS with Swift/ Objective-C.
If you like to know the field from the within out, optimization and reasoning are your second name – offer C/ C ++ a chance. Do not believe that these are obsolete languages- there are still a great deal of applications as well as they occupy high settings (top10) among one of the most popular programs languages.
If you wish to quickly have the chance to do something certain – I highly suggest Python or Ruby. Both are languages of general application, so you can attain them a lot. Are these all possibilities? Absolutely not! The shows language for novices is a debatable matter. It’s hard to locate the best option.
If you have no concept, must read modern novels start with Python or Ruby
The Polish educational program predicts graphical languages first – Logo design, Scrape, then Pascal. Higher research studies commonly begin with C/ C ++ or Pascal, then go to Java/ C # with an additional mix of other languages. Novice shows training courses utilize many different languages, yet it is usually Python or Ruby.
On-line forums have lots of conversation on where to start, but there is no agreement on the most effective one. If you have no concept, start with Python or Ruby. See which of these languages has far better regional support – single-interest group, normal meetups, intermittent totally free courses for novices, etc. and start working!
The most effective will be the language that will certainly attract you in as well as urge you to find out:-RRB- In a nutshell – the one you pick will be the most effective. At the end I advise you a traditional post that provides you a great view of finding out programming throughout the years and transforms the technique to the whole subject:
“Discover how to program in One Decade” Peter Norvig [EN] Polish translation regrettably does not function – allow me know if you choose to read in the area. Amongst all programming languages readily available on the marketplace, Java is the indisputable leader in regards to popularity of use.
Technique is the key to success in programs must read modern novels
As a Java object-oriented language, it gives practically unlimited opportunities of creating applications and their subsequent growth. The appeal of Java suggests that people concentrating on programming in this language can rely on a wide variety of task supplies with great financial conditions. must read modern novels This makes increasingly more people curious about finding out programming in Java.
On the marketplace, we could locate a variety of books for learning Java, the Net is full of totally free overviews, blog sites and also discussion forums devoted to problems related to it, there are also complimentary as well as paid programs programs in Java. Which of these options is the most effective option for people who intend to find out Java from scratch? Technique is the key to success in programs.
Although books include the most vital shows expertise as well as are a wonderful compendium of expertise, they typically concentrate on selected shows components, restricting the field of view to future designers. Absolutely nothing likewise aids in discovering the shows itself as programming itself.
Focusing only on the concept, also if we know it completely well, it will certainly be tough for us to apply the gotten understanding promptly. Method is essential to boost your skills. The perfect solution is to integrate concept with technique, which programs programs are suitable for.
Job without a contract It is tough to disagree with the fact that paperwork is nothing pleasant
Nevertheless, it must be kept in mind that finding out programs takes some time. Understanding the basics of shows can and also will certainly not be a great challenge, yet knowledge of Java calls for several written lines of code.
what to bear in mind when selecting a freelance profession path? what to do to make self-employment bring not just satisfaction, however also cash? An occupation in IT does not have to involve a full time task. Among programmers, internet developers and testers there are more and more individuals who choose to give up a warm work for self-employment.
Being a consultant tempts you with flexible working hours, liberty of action and also the capacity to select orders and clients with which you intend to cooperate. However, this is additionally a heavy item of bread, which is best recognized to those who after the beginning of the adventure of a consultant, after some time returned under the employer’s wings.
Disappointments and behaviors usually have mistakes that also happen to experienced freelancers. We take the most important of them under the microscope. Job without a contract It is tough to disagree with the fact that paperwork is nothing pleasant. Defining the regards to cooperation with the client in composing, nevertheless, is the golden principle of self-employment and the standard form of security.
Way too many orders must read modern novels Amongst the biggest fears of each freelancer there is a shortage of customers
Of course you could not think ahead of time that every person is simply waiting for a minute to cheat us, yet even a single scenario, when the customer will certainly not wish to pay or change the preliminary setups for the scope of job, could be a bitter experience, which is unworthy running the risk of.
It is for a factor that consultants are said to be split into those that authorize agreements as well as those who will certainly soon do so. Way too many orders Amongst the biggest fears of each freelancer there is a shortage of customers. must read modern novels However, as it turns out, taking too many orders for fear of absence of appropriate job flow could have similarly deadly repercussions.
Taking a few big projects simultaneously is not only a straightforward way to overwork and overdose of high levels of caffeine, but also an even worse top quality of job as well as the threat of failure to meet due dates. Obviously, it impacts the reputation of a consultant who in his situation determines to be an expert or otherwise to be.
Node.js Software Designer Work provide IT – Warsaw/ Grodzisk Mazowiecki Attractive income An excellent chance for an expert growth. of one of the most common mistakes, especially newbie freelancers, is the belief that the only thing you can take on others is price.